app开发软件java

Java是一种广泛使用的编程语言,被广泛应用于移动应用开发、Web开发、游戏开发等领域。它是一种跨平台的语言,可以在不同的操作系统上运行。在本文中,我将详细介绍Java开发软件的原理和基本知识。

Java开发软件的原理是基于Java虚拟机(JVM)的。Java虚拟机是Java程序的运行环境,它可以在不同的操作系统上运行Java程序。Java程序首先被编译成字节码,然后由Java虚拟机解释执行。这种解释执行的方式使得Java程序具有跨平台的特性,即同一个Java程序可以在不同的操作系统上运行。

Java开发软件的基本知识包括以下几个方面:

1. Java语法:Java语法是编写Java程序的基本规则,包括语句、变量、数据类型、运算符等。了解Java语法可以帮助我们编写正确的Java程序。

2. Java类和对象:Java是一种面向对象的语言,所有的代码都是以类的形式组织的。类是对象的模板,对象是类的实例。了解类和对象的概念可以帮助我们理解Java程序的结构。

3. Java标准库:Java标准库是一组预定义的类和接口,提供了各种常用的功能,例如输入输出、字符串处理、日期时间处理等。熟悉Java标准库可以提高我们的开发效率。

4. Java开发工具:Java开发工具包括编译器、调试器、集成开发环境等。编译器将Java源代码编译成字节码,调试器可以帮助我们调试Java程序,集成开发环境提供了一套完整的开发工具。

5. Java框架和库:Java框架和库是一些已经实现好的功能模块,可以帮助我们快速开发Java程序。例如Spring框架可以帮助我们实现企业级应用,Hibernate框架可以帮助我们实现数据库操作。

总结一下,Java开发软件的原理是基于Java虚拟机的,Java开发软件的基本知识包括Java语法、类和对象、Java标准库、Java开发工具和Java框架和库。熟悉这些知识可以帮助我们编写高效、可靠的Java程序。如果你想学习Java开发软件,可以通过阅读相关的书籍和教程,参加培训课程,实践编写Java程序等方式来提高自己的技能水平。

川公网安备 51019002001185号